Serwis Ars Technica przyjrzał się postępowi prac Mozilli nad dodaniem doprzeglądarki Firefox funkcji otwierania poszczególnych stron wosobnych procesach. Rozwiązanie to, wykorzystywane już np. przezGoogle Chrome, zostało przez twórców nazwane Electrolysis. Wedługprogramistów wprowadzenie go do Firefoksa znacząco poprawistabilność, wydajność i bezpieczeństwo jego działania. W przypadkuzawieszenia się jednej zakładki pozostałe będą nadal poprawniefunkcjonować. Rozszerzenie przeglądarki o taką opcję nie jest łatwym zadaniem.Wiele kluczowych dla działania aplikacji komponentów musi zostaćznacząco zmodyfikowana. Aktualnie przeglądarka wyświetla strony wpojedynczym obiekcie, którego zawartość jest zmieniana w zależnościod wybranej przez użytkownika zakładki. Otwieranie poszczególnychkart i okien jako osobne procesy zwiększy stabilność przeglądarki.Błędnie napisany plugin nie spowoduje zawieszenia całejprzeglądarki. Powstały już pierwsze prototypy i zaprezentowano kilka wersjidemonstracyjnych nowego rozwiązania. Pokazano wnich, że interfejs przeglądarki można całkowicie odizolować odzawartości wyświetlanej strony. Warto dodać, że część kodu źródłowego wykorzystana przezprogramistów pochodzi z projektu Chromium - źródeł Google Chrome. StworzenieElectrolysis jest olbrzymim wyzwaniem dla twórców Firefoksa. Niewiadomo jeszcze, czy pojawi się w następnej wersjiprzeglądarki.
Redakcja
07.07.2009 22:16